Lately my welder has been acting up. You know when the thermostatic overload starts kicking in cutting the feed of wire when you've been welding alot? That's what mine is doing all the time. Eventually I can get it to work long enough to run a bead but for the most part it kicks a bit of wire out then cuts out. You pull the trigger, it spits 1/8" of wire then it just stops on you. Pull the trigger again, same thing. I've tried pulling the gun apart and everything looks really clean and I've probably only fed 35 pounds or so through it.
Any ideas?
